Family and Education
b. 29 July 1752, 2nd s. of Lord George Manners Sutton by 1st w. Diana, da. of Thomas Chaplin of Blankney, Lincs.; bro. of George Sutton and Thomas Manners Sutton. educ. ?Eton. m. Apr. 1778, his cos. Anne, illegit. da. of John Manners, Mq. of Granby, 5s. 1da. suc. bro. George 1804.
Offices Held
Page of honour to George III 1765 – 76.
Ensign, 2 Ft. Gds. 1768, lt. and capt. 1775, capt. and lt.-col. 1780, ret. 1790.
Sheriff, Notts. 1808–9.
Parlimentarian
Main residence: Kelham, Notts.
